    Hump and bump is next weekend with guided trail runs on friday the 5th and saturday the 6th. these rate from 2 to 5 and are good for stock to super modifieds. just come out to the clark county fairgrounds in logandale all the runs will be held at the logandale trails system. there is a fee which is tax deductable and camping is avialable at the fairgrounds.

    on saturday night there will be a huge raffle and a catered BBQ

    this would be a great time to take a break from the mall and come check out logandale trails system.

    You guys missed a great run.

    the raffle was for 39K worth of stuff play another bunch of stuff that was donated later.
    winches, tires, power tanks,lockers gear and axel sets and all kinds of other stuff was raffled off. hundreds of t-shirts and can coozies were thrown out to the crowd.

    the runs were awesome and at you leasure and off road mag were in attandance.

    noteable sponsers were Ted Weins, Adams Drive shaft, and Maximum Off Road.

    there were around 200 drivers including clubs from as far away as Idaho and Canada.

    the kids raffle alone gave away at least 4 bikes and took 30 or 40 minutes.
